← ScienceWhich risk increases when a mixing vessel's residence time decreases?
A)Elevated concentration of reactant gradients✓
B)Reduced selectivity for side products
C)Higher observed rate constant values
D)Increased reactor temperature stability
💡 Explanation
Decreased residence time causes reactant gradients because insufficient MIXING occurs, reducing homogeneity. Therefore, reactant concentrations will not be uniformly distributed, rather than achieving optimal reaction rates or increased temperature stability that are desired objectives with adequate residence time.
